BLACK MARINES OPEN SEGREGATED RECRUIT DEPOT
Montford Point, North Carolina • August 26, 1942 On this date in 1942, 12 miles/19 km upriver from the new whites-only amphibious training camp at Camp Lejeune, the first set of black Marine Corps recruits set up a segregated recruit depot of their own. The training camp, named Montford Point, was a satellite camp of Camp Lejeune…
